HR Technology HCM Specialist
Company overview
Our client is a global medical technology manufacturer, with a leading portfolio across Orthopaedics, Sports Medicine, ENT and Advanced Wound Management.
Job overview
Outside Remote Daily rate negotiable
Working as part of a team and reporting to the Director of HR Technology Service Delivery and Global HCM Product Owner, this role will be responsible for providing excellent customer service and performing Key HR deliverables related to Workday HCM and all core processes. With a customer-focused and professional manner, this role will be the first point of contact for HR Tech queries from our customer base comprising employees & managers at all levels and from all areas of the business.
Duties will include delivering Workday enhancements under appropriate Change Management practices, small projects, educating our people on the use of Workday, and producing relevant documentation in line with agreed internal processes.
Having excellent organizational and administrative skills this person will manage different initiatives, including HR Projects, assuming the role of Functional lead and supporting hypercare activities

What will you be doing?
- Gathering and document user requirements
- Deliver and implement new HCM solutions
- Troubleshooting and resolving technical HCM issues, suggesting improvements
- Ensuring effective change management and communication
- Managing data and mass data uploads
- Support Workday bi-annual releases
- Organize and Coordinate UAT rounds, write testing scenarios, assisting test population and troubleshoot issues until resolution
- Participating in system-related projects and enhancements under the optic of Workday HCM
- In the short term – contributing to a critical transformation programme and delivering some key Workday changes in HCM.
What will you need to be successful?
- Workday functional knowledge and experience in global projects, data structure and security
- Knowledge of Workday HCM and Security
- Knowledge/experience in Workday Extend is desirable
- Experience with Global HR teams
- Understanding of HR Technology vendors and implementations in multiple markets
- Knowledge of data privacy regulations and global HR processes.
- Effective workload management and prioritization capabilities to handle various tasks efficiently.
- Experience in process and service improvement.
